哎哟喂,小伙伴们,手里拿着“小程序”,脸上挂着“升级”的笑容,心里盘算着:云服务器换不换?换哪个?咋操作?别慌,这篇文章让你一次性搞定“换云服务器”的全过程,而且不带泪!只要你会点鼠标,会点键盘,剩下的交给我。咱们走起!
**第一步:准备工作,别搞“盲人摸象”**
在动手之前,先搞清楚你现有“小程序”的部署状态。是不是搭在某个云平台?例如腾讯云、阿里云、华为云、百度云,还是其他“各色云”!记住,别着急“跟风”,先确认你当前云上的“配置”:服务器IP、账号密码、数据库信息、存储路径、SSL证书……这些都是“换云”时的重要信息。
同时,你还得做好“备份”。这是什么意思?简单来说,就是把你的小程序文件、数据库、配置数据像“家里存钱罐”一样统统打包带走,别到时候出现“还没备份,崩盘了”的尴尬。可以用工具导出数据库,拉取代码,备份整个文件夹,确保一道“存包”走。
**第二步:挑选“新云”——智慧点,货比三家**
云平台多如牛毛,价格、性能、售后,这三大“砝码”可不能忽视。是不是觉得价格便宜的就一定好?嘿,小伙伴,别被“钓鱼”了!便宜的云可能有“卡顿、掉包”风险,贵的云也不一定“直上青云”。
现在市面上火的几家主要云平台:腾讯云、阿里云、华为云、百度云、京东云。你得考虑几个点:1)你的小程序部署需求(高性能还是经济实惠);2)服务器的地域(离用户近点,省流量、快加载);3)支持的技术架构(例如是否支持你用的框架和数据库);4)售后支持和技术渠道贴不贴心。
广告时间:想赚点零花钱?玩游戏也能赚零花钱,点我看看:bbs.77.ink
**第三步:迁移策略—“拆弹”还是“新建”?**
你准备“直接搬家”还是“原地升级”?
- 直接迁移:就是把老云上的网站、数据库、配置全搬到新云上。这适合现成“稳定版”,只想换个“快递公司”。
- 增量迁移:新旧同时运行一段时间,测试无误后切换。像“排除万难”地把新云“上线”稳定后,再逐步关掉旧云。
迁移时,“无痛洗盘”很关键:
- 复制网站代码:用Git或者SCP上传到新云服务器。
- 数据库迁移:用数据库管理工具导出/导入(比如phpMyAdmin、Navicat)。
- 调整配置:根据新云的“IP、端口、路径”调整配置文件。
- 改DNS:将域名解析指向新云,记得“缩短TTL值”,减少等待时间。
**第四步:测试调优——“试水”阶段**
上线前可别大意,要“沙盘推演”一下。检查内容包括:
- 网站是否正常访问?加载速度是否提升?响应时间OK吗?
- 数据库链接是否顺畅?数据是否完整且无错(别让“数据丢失”偷偷溜走)?
- SSL证书是否配置正确?保证HTTPS安全浏览。
- 监控指标:CPU、内存、带宽、IO等,看是否超载。
有时,你会发现新云的不稳定,可能是配置问题、网络问题或者兼容性问题。这个时候,用“调试工具”找“线索”,或询问“云平台客服”,别黄了脸皮。
**第五步:正式切换——“逆风翻盘”!**
经过“试水”确认无误,开始正式改DNS,切换到新云地址。注意不要瞬间全rollback,否则会“让用户踩雷”。
切换完毕后,密切监控网站运行状态。如果发现异常,就登上“云端后台”,查看“报警信息”,先“堵漏”,再“修复”。
最后:“旧云”可以选择“存档”或者“关停”——别让它乱跑,交由“存储”或“备份仓库”管理。
**老司机tips**:换云不只是“搬家”,也是“升级”。你可以考虑自动化脚本,比如使用“Terraform”或者“Ansible”来做批量迁移。减少人力误差,也让迁移变得像“开挂”。
别忘了,换完云后,要定期“巡检”云环境,保持“云端的青春永驻”。
总之,这个“换云”大工程,像是在“玩俄罗斯方块”——每个块都要拼得精准、稳妥,不然就“Game Over”。而且,别忘了,玩游戏想要赚零花钱就上七评赏金榜,网站地址:bbs.77.ink
还在犹豫?一流的云平台都在等你“挑衅”,只要勇敢迈出第一步,就像“开挂”一样,未来的小程序很快就能“云端飞翔”。